The probability of the Federal Reserve cutting interest rates by 25 basis points in October rises to 96.2%.
ChainCatcher news, according to Golden Ten Data, CME "FedWatch" shows that the probability of the Federal Reserve keeping interest rates unchanged in October is 3.8%, while the probability of a 25 basis point rate cut has risen to 96.2%. In addition, the probability of keeping rates unchanged in December is 0.7%, the cumulative probability of a 25 basis point rate cut is 21.9%, and the cumulative probability of a 50 basis point rate cut is 77.3%.
